Best Ways to Travel from Havana to Cienfuegos
Planning your trip from Havana to Cienfuegos? It’s important to choose the right transportation. You can pick based on what matters most to you: convenience, cost, or flexibility.
Public Bus Services
Public buses are a budget-friendly choice. Companies like Astro and Transtur run regular routes. Prices are around $10 to $20.
Private Taxi Options
For a more personal ride, try private taxis. Services like Havana Taxi cost between $50 to $100. This depends on the vehicle and services.
Organized Tours
Organized tours offer a special way to travel. Daytrip tours, for example, include stops like Finca Vigia and Mirador de Bacunayagua. You get door-to-door service too.
Car Rental Considerations
Car rentals give you freedom and ease. Companies like Rex and Cubacar start at $40 a day. Prices vary by vehicle and rental time.

Must-Visit Attractions in Cienfuegos
Planning a Cuba vacation? Don’t miss Cienfuegos. Known as the “Pearl of the South,” it’s a city with a unique mix of architecture. You’ll see neoclassical and French styles, making it a UNESCO World Heritage Site.
The Teatro Tomás Terry is a top tourist attraction here. It’s a beautiful theater that hosts cultural events. You can take a tour to see its stunning interior and learn about its history.
For a full sightseeing tour of Cienfuegos, check out these spots:
- Parque José MartÃ, a park with historic buildings
- Palacio de Valle, a palace with amazing architecture and views
- Museo de las Artes Palacio Ferrer, a museum with art, music memorabilia, and unique interiors

Essential Travel Tips and Safety Information
Getting ready for your trip from Havana to Cienfuegos? It’s key to know some travel tips and safety info. This will help make your journey smooth and fun. Knowing about local money, how to communicate, and health tips is crucial.
In Cuba, you’ll find two currencies: the Cuban Peso (CUP) and the Moneda Libremente Convertible (MLC). The exchange fee is 3%, with an extra 10% for USD. You can exchange money at the airport or a bank. Also, think about buying a WiFi card for $1.50 to $2.50 CUC per hour to stay online.
Currency and Payment Methods
Carrying both cash and credit cards is wise. Some places might take credit cards, but having local money is safer. You can also get cash from ATMs, but watch out for fees.
Communication Tips
It’s important to stay in touch with loved ones. You can buy a SIM card or a WiFi card to get online. Learning basic Spanish, like “gracias” and “¿dónde está…?”, will also help you around.
Health and Safety Precautions
Don’t forget to take care of your health and safety. Get travel insurance, which is needed to enter Cuba. Also, get vaccinated before you go. Always be aware of your surroundings and keep an eye on your stuff, mainly in busy places.
